Section 1: Understanding Collagen – The Foundation of Beauty and Wellness
Collagen, derived from the Greek word «kolla» meaning glue, is the most abundant protein in the human body. It serves as a crucial building block for various tissues, including skin, bones, tendons, ligaments, cartilage, and even blood vessels. Think of it as the scaffolding that provides structure, strength, and elasticity throughout our system. Without sufficient collagen, our bodies would literally fall apart.
There are at least 28 different types of collagen, each with a unique amino acid composition and structural organization. However, types I, II, and III constitute the vast majority of collagen found in the human body.
-
Type I Collagen: The most prevalent type, comprising around 90% of the body’s total collagen. Primarily found in skin, tendons, ligaments, bones, and teeth, Type I collagen provides tensile strength and resistance to stretching. It’s critical for maintaining skin elasticity, wound healing, and bone density.
-
Type II Collagen: Predominantly found in cartilage, the flexible connective tissue that cushions joints. Type II collagen provides compressive strength, enabling cartilage to withstand pressure and impact. It’s essential for joint health and mobility.
-
Type III Collagen: Often found alongside Type I collagen, particularly in skin, blood vessels, and internal organs. Type III collagen contributes to elasticity and structural integrity, playing a crucial role in tissue repair and wound healing. It also supports the health of blood vessels, contributing to cardiovascular function.
The human body naturally produces collagen, using amino acids obtained from dietary protein. However, collagen production declines with age, typically starting in our mid-20s. This decline is accelerated by factors such as sun exposure, smoking, excessive sugar intake, and a poor diet. As collagen levels decrease, visible signs of aging become apparent, including wrinkles, sagging skin, joint pain, and decreased bone density.
The decline in collagen synthesis impacts various aspects of health and well-being. In the skin, it leads to reduced elasticity, fine lines, and wrinkles. In joints, it contributes to cartilage degradation and joint pain. In bones, it can lead to decreased bone density and increased risk of fractures.
To combat the age-related decline in collagen, individuals are increasingly turning to collagen supplements. These supplements provide the body with readily available collagen peptides, which can be used to support collagen synthesis and potentially mitigate the effects of collagen loss. The efficacy and bioavailability of collagen supplements, however, are subjects of ongoing research and debate.
Section 2: Exploring the Landscape of Collagen Supplements – Types, Sources, and Formulations
The market for collagen supplements has exploded in recent years, offering a diverse range of products with varying types, sources, and formulations. Understanding these differences is crucial for making informed choices and selecting a supplement that aligns with individual needs and preferences.
-
Hydrolyzed Collagen (Collagen Peptides): This is the most common form of collagen supplement. Hydrolyzed collagen is broken down into smaller peptides, making it easier for the body to absorb and utilize. The hydrolysis process involves breaking the long collagen chains into shorter fragments, which are more readily absorbed through the intestinal lining. Most collagen supplements are available in hydrolyzed form.
-
Gelatin: This is a cooked form of collagen that is typically used in food products, such as gelatin desserts and gummy candies. Gelatin contains larger collagen molecules compared to hydrolyzed collagen, which may make it less easily absorbed. However, it can still provide some benefits, particularly for gut health.
-
Undenatured Type II Collagen: This form of collagen is derived from chicken sternal cartilage and is intended to support joint health. It works through a different mechanism than hydrolyzed collagen. Instead of providing building blocks for collagen synthesis, undenatured type II collagen is believed to work by modulating the immune system and reducing inflammation in the joints.
-
Sources of Collagen: Collagen supplements are derived from various animal sources, including:
- Bovine Collagen: Derived from cows, bovine collagen is primarily composed of Type I and Type III collagen. It’s a popular choice for supporting skin, bone, and joint health.
- Porcine Collagen: Derived from pigs, porcine collagen is also primarily composed of Type I and Type III collagen. It’s another common source for collagen supplements.
- Marine Collagen: Derived from fish, marine collagen is primarily composed of Type I collagen. It’s often considered a more sustainable and environmentally friendly option compared to bovine or porcine collagen. Marine collagen is also known for its smaller particle size, which may enhance absorption.
- Chicken Collagen: Derived from chicken cartilage, chicken collagen is primarily composed of Type II collagen. It’s specifically targeted for joint health.
-
Formulations: Collagen supplements are available in various forms, including:
- Powders: Collagen powders are versatile and can be easily mixed into beverages, smoothies, or food. They often contain a higher concentration of collagen per serving.
- Capsules/Tablets: Collagen capsules and tablets are convenient for on-the-go consumption. However, they may contain a lower concentration of collagen per serving compared to powders.
- Liquids: Liquid collagen supplements are often pre-mixed and ready to drink. They may be more palatable than powders, but can also be more expensive.
- Gummies: Collagen gummies are a palatable and convenient option, but often contain added sugars and artificial flavors.
-
Ingredients to Look For: Besides the type and source of collagen, it’s important to consider other ingredients in the supplement.
- Vitamin C: Vitamin C is essential for collagen synthesis and helps to protect collagen from damage.
- Hyaluronic Acid: Hyaluronic acid is a humectant that helps to hydrate the skin and improve its elasticity.
- Biotin: Biotin is a B vitamin that supports healthy hair, skin, and nails.
- Zinc: Zinc is a mineral that is involved in collagen synthesis and wound healing.
- Copper: Copper is a mineral that is essential for cross-linking collagen fibers.
Section 3: Emerging Trends in Collagen Supplementation – Novel Ingredients and Delivery Systems
The collagen supplement market is constantly evolving, with new ingredients and delivery systems emerging to enhance efficacy and improve user experience.
-
Eggshell Membrane Collagen: This is a relatively new source of collagen that is derived from the membrane of eggshells. It contains a naturally occurring combination of collagen types I, V, and X, as well as other beneficial nutrients, such as hyaluronic acid, glucosamine, and chondroitin sulfate. Eggshell membrane collagen is believed to support joint health, skin health, and hair growth.
-
Vegan Collagen Boosters: While true collagen is derived from animal sources, there are vegan supplements that contain ingredients that support the body’s natural collagen production. These ingredients may include:
- Amino Acids: Specific amino acids, such as glycine, proline, and lysine, are the building blocks of collagen. Vegan supplements may contain these amino acids to support collagen synthesis.
- Vitamin C: As mentioned earlier, vitamin C is essential for collagen synthesis.
- Silica: Silica is a mineral that is believed to support collagen production and bone health.
-
Liposomal Collagen: Liposomes are tiny, spherical vesicles that can encapsulate collagen peptides and deliver them directly to cells. This targeted delivery system may enhance absorption and bioavailability.
-
Fermented Collagen: Fermentation is a process that can break down collagen into smaller peptides, making it easier for the body to absorb. Fermented collagen may also have enhanced antioxidant and anti-inflammatory properties.
-
Personalized Collagen: Some companies are offering personalized collagen supplements based on individual needs and preferences. These supplements may be formulated based on factors such as age, gender, lifestyle, and specific health concerns.
-
Collagen Beauty Drinks: These are ready-to-drink beverages that contain collagen peptides and other beauty-enhancing ingredients, such as vitamins, minerals, and antioxidants. They offer a convenient and palatable way to consume collagen.
-
Collagen Topical Products: While the focus is often on ingestible collagen, topical collagen creams and serums are also available. These products aim to deliver collagen directly to the skin, where it can help to improve hydration, elasticity, and reduce the appearance of wrinkles. However, the effectiveness of topical collagen is still debated, as collagen molecules are relatively large and may not penetrate the skin barrier effectively.

Section 5: Scientific Evidence and Research – What Does the Data Say?
The scientific evidence supporting the benefits of collagen supplements is growing, but more research is needed to fully understand their efficacy and optimal usage.
-
Skin Health: Several studies have shown that collagen supplementation can improve skin hydration, elasticity, and reduce the appearance of wrinkles. A meta-analysis published in the Journal of Cosmetic Dermatology in 2019 analyzed 11 studies and found that oral collagen supplementation significantly improved skin elasticity, hydration, and dermal collagen density. Another study published in the Journal of Agricultural and Food Chemistry in 2015 found that marine collagen peptides improved skin hydration and reduced wrinkles in women.
-
Joint Health: Research suggests that collagen supplementation can help to reduce joint pain and stiffness in individuals with osteoarthritis. A meta-analysis published in Osteoarthritis and Cartilage in 2011 analyzed five studies and found that collagen hydrolysate supplementation significantly reduced joint pain in patients with osteoarthritis. A study published in Current Medical Research and Opinion in 2009 found that undenatured type II collagen reduced joint pain and improved physical function in patients with knee osteoarthritis.
-
Bone Health: Some studies suggest that collagen supplementation can improve bone density and reduce the risk of fractures, particularly in postmenopausal women. A study published in Nutrients in 2018 found that collagen peptide supplementation increased bone mineral density in postmenopausal women with osteopenia.
-
Muscle Mass: Emerging research suggests that collagen supplementation may help to increase muscle mass and strength, particularly when combined with resistance training. A study published in the British Journal of Nutrition in 2015 found that collagen peptide supplementation increased muscle mass and strength in elderly men undergoing resistance training.
-
Wound Healing: Collagen plays a crucial role in wound healing, and some studies suggest that collagen supplementation can accelerate the healing process. A study published in the Journal of Wound Care in 2014 found that collagen dressings improved wound healing in patients with chronic ulcers.
However, it’s important to note that many of these studies are relatively small and have limitations. More large-scale, well-controlled studies are needed to confirm the benefits of collagen supplements and determine the optimal dosage and duration of treatment. Furthermore, individual responses to collagen supplementation may vary depending on factors such as age, genetics, diet, and lifestyle.
Section 6: Potential Side Effects, Interactions, and Contraindications – Safety Considerations
Collagen supplements are generally considered safe for most people, but potential side effects, interactions, and contraindications should be considered.
-
Side Effects: Common side effects of collagen supplements include:
- Digestive Issues: Some individuals may experience mild digestive issues, such as bloating, gas, or diarrhea, particularly when taking high doses of collagen.
- Bad Taste: Some collagen supplements may have an unpleasant taste or odor.
- Allergic Reactions: Allergic reactions to collagen supplements are rare, but possible, especially in individuals with allergies to the animal source of the collagen (e.g., fish, shellfish, beef, or chicken).
- Hypercalcemia: Marine collagen derived from shark cartilage may contain high levels of calcium and could potentially lead to hypercalcemia (high blood calcium levels) in susceptible individuals.
-
Interactions: Collagen supplements may interact with certain medications, including:
- Blood Thinners: Collagen may have mild blood-thinning effects, which could potentially increase the risk of bleeding in individuals taking blood thinners, such as warfarin.
- Calcium Supplements: Collagen derived from shark cartilage may contain high levels of calcium and could potentially interact with calcium supplements, increasing the risk of hypercalcemia.
-
Contraindications: Collagen supplements may not be suitable for everyone. Individuals with the following conditions should consult with a healthcare professional before taking collagen supplements:
- Allergies: Individuals with known allergies to the animal source of the collagen should avoid supplements derived from that source.
- Kidney Disease: Individuals with kidney disease should use caution when taking collagen supplements, as excessive protein intake can strain the kidneys.
- Autoimmune Diseases: Some individuals with autoimmune diseases, such as lupus or rheumatoid arthritis, may experience a worsening of their symptoms with collagen supplementation.
- Pregnancy and Breastfeeding: There is limited research on the safety of collagen supplements during pregnancy and breastfeeding. Pregnant and breastfeeding women should consult with a healthcare professional before taking collagen supplements.

Section 8: Optimizing Collagen Supplementation – Dosage, Timing, and Lifestyle Factors
To maximize the benefits of collagen supplementation, it’s important to consider the optimal dosage, timing, and lifestyle factors.
-
Dosage: The optimal dosage of collagen supplements varies depending on the individual and their specific needs. However, most studies suggest that a daily dose of 10-20 grams of hydrolyzed collagen peptides is effective for improving skin health, joint health, and bone health. For undenatured type II collagen, the typical dose is 40mg per day.
-
Timing: The timing of collagen supplementation is not critical, but some experts recommend taking collagen on an empty stomach, as this may enhance absorption. You can take collagen in the morning, afternoon, or evening, depending on your preference.
-
Lifestyle Factors: Several lifestyle factors can impact collagen production and effectiveness. These include:
- Diet: A diet rich in protein, vitamin C, and other essential nutrients is crucial for supporting collagen synthesis. Ensure you consume adequate protein from sources such as meat, poultry, fish, eggs, beans, and lentils. Also, include plenty of fruits and vegetables, which are rich in vitamin C and other antioxidants.
- Sun Protection: Excessive sun exposure can damage collagen fibers and accelerate skin aging. Protect your skin from the sun by wearing sunscreen, hats, and protective clothing.
- Smoking: Smoking damages collagen fibers and impairs collagen synthesis. Quitting smoking is one of the best things you can do for your skin and overall health.
- Hydration: Staying well-hydrated is important for maintaining skin elasticity and supporting collagen production. Drink plenty of water throughout the day.
- Sleep: Getting enough sleep is essential for collagen synthesis and overall health. Aim for 7-8 hours of sleep per night.
- Exercise: Regular exercise can help to stimulate collagen production and improve overall health. Engage in both cardiovascular exercise and resistance training.
- Stress Management: Chronic stress can negatively impact collagen production. Practice stress-management techniques, such as yoga, meditation, or spending time in nature.
By optimizing these lifestyle factors, you can enhance the benefits of collagen supplementation and improve your overall health and well-being.
